2. Core Gameplay Made for Short Sessions
The game’s structure is intentionally simple: set a bet, choose a difficulty, watch the chicken move step by step, and decide when to stop. Because every decision is manual, you’re not waiting for an auto‑crash timer – you’re in control of the pace.
Each round finishes in under a minute if you cash out early or hit a trap quickly. That speed keeps adrenaline high and boredom low.
- Easy mode: 24 steps – low risk, quick finish.
- Hardcore mode: 15 steps – high risk, but still under two minutes.
3. Rapid‑Risk Levels for Instant Gratification
The four difficulty settings let you fine‑tune how fast you want your session to go. If you’re in a hurry to test the game, start with Easy or Medium; they offer more steps but fewer chances to lose everything at once.
Players who want a real adrenaline rush jump straight into Hard or Hardcore – the chicken crosses fewer tiles but each step carries a higher probability of hitting a trap.
- Easy – 24 steps, lowest loss chance.
- Medium – 22 steps, balanced risk.
- Hard – 20 steps, higher multiplier potential.
- Hardcore – 15 steps, maximum volatility.
